Output c43f91f8a340a7a0b539e3fde99bb302626a87c9fb55f585049c3bdc6f8ec591:58

value
75000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 989a8600118c68f1d016d43bc30bf34564dd507d OP_EQUALVERIFY OP_CHECKSIG
address
1EutpdpzjoFT22fyvR9d8UL9U2nPaP7sLM
transaction
c43f91f8a340a7a0b539e3fde99bb302626a87c9fb55f585049c3bdc6f8ec591
confirmations
214661
spent
true